The NSA has given up on denying things...

The NSA has given up trying to deny things... now in statements it just acknowledges programs by name and says they're being used legally.

Today's revelation: everything we do over HTTP is being stored and is easily searchable.

There used to be a time when they denied the existence of things. Now it is statements like:

Quote:
"XKeyscore is used as a part of NSA's lawful foreign signals intelligence collection system.

"Allegations of widespread, unchecked analyst access to NSA collection data are simply not true. Access to XKeyscore, as well as all of NSA's analytic tools, is limited to only those personnel who require access for their assigned tasks ? In addition, there are multiple technical, manual and supervisory checks and balances within the system to prevent deliberate misuse from occurring."

"Every search by an NSA analyst is fully auditable, to ensure that they are proper and within the law.

"These types of programs allow us to collect the information that enables us to perform our missions successfully ? to defend the nation and to protect US and allied troops abroad."
